| 15:57 | emes | how can i generate a backtrace for a seg fault? mythfrontend is seg faulting if it tries to play fullscreen video, -v all doesn't show any errors |
| 15:57 | emes | using 0.16 |
| 15:57 | stoffel | recompile myth for debugging and follow the debugging docs from www.mythtv.org |
| 15:58 | --- | ---> hadees [~hadees@cs7011320-102.austin.rr.com] has joined #mythtv |
| 15:58 | emes | it is compiled with debug |
| 15:59 | stoffel | http://www.mythtv.org/docs/mythtv-HOWTO-20.html#ss20.2 |
| 16:00 | --- | <<-- KaZeR [~kazer@84.98.204.3] has quit (Connection timed out) |
| 16:02 | --- | ---> KaZeR [~kazer@84.98.204.3] has joined #mythtv |
| 16:03 | --- | <<-- KaZeR [~kazer@84.98.204.3] has quit (Read error: 232 (Connection reset by peer)) |
| 16:03 | emes | ok, i'm running it un gdb, when it tries to play fullscreen video, it just stays on a black screen, and ctrl-c doesnt get out of it, how do i get back to gdb? i had to killall it |
| 16:03 | emes | s/un/in/ |
| 16:03 | --- | ---> KaZeR [~kazer@84.98.204.3] has joined #mythtv |
| 16:06 | emes | but, it was at: 0xb7d97b61 in get_avf_buffer_xvmc(AVCodecContext*, AVFrame*) (c=0x82c21c8, |
| 16:06 | emes | pic=0x8627790) at avformatdecoder.cpp:689 when it got the sigsegv |
| 16:06 | --- | <<-- Delemas [~Delemas@CPE000c420209af-CM00111ae61f20.cpe.net.cable.rogers.com] has quit ("Client exiting") |
| 16:06 | emes | stoffel: does that mean anything to you? |
| 16:07 | Chutt | it means you enabled xvmc when you don't have a video card capable of doing it. |
| 16:07 | stoffel | same as chinese to me ;) |
| 16:14 | emes | Chutt: i cant find that option |
| 16:15 | --- | ---> Dibblah1_ [~Dibblah@82-41-94-93.cable.ubr02.dund.blueyonder.co.uk] has joined #mythtv |
| 16:18 | stoffel | emes: in settings.pro |
| 16:19 | Chutt | you specifically enabled it when you compiled things. |

| 16:31 | Chutt | people that replace the cflags with their own (unless they have to for an epia board that doesn't do ppro) do not get support. |
| 16:31 | Dibblah1_ | ... Or at least should know how to turn it back to defaults. |
| 16:31 | Dibblah1_ | However, this is in the official Gentoo ebuild. |
| 16:32 | Dibblah1_ | And there's no easy way to turn it off. |
| 16:32 | Chutt | maybe i'll have to go smack the gentoo packager again |
| 16:32 | emes | well, everything is working now, so i'm happy |
| 16:35 | Dibblah1_ | It's different from the last attempt... |
| 16:35 | Dibblah1_ | local cpu="`get-flag march || get-flag mcpu`" |
| 16:35 | Dibblah1_ | if [ "${cpu}" ] ; then |
| 16:35 | Dibblah1_ | sed -e "s:pentiumpro:${cpu}:g" -i "settings.pro" || die |
| 16:35 | Dibblah1_ | "sed failed" |
| 16:35 | Dibblah1_ | fi |
| 16:35 | Dibblah1_ | Nice error message, there. |
| 16:35 | --- | <<-- levon [~levon@83.137.99.168] has quit (Remote closed the connection) |
| 16:38 | Dibblah1_ | Exactly the same thing in the unofficial Myth CVS ebuild. |
| 16:39 | Chutt | see, that's just plain moronic |
| 16:39 | Chutt | ppro generally produces the best code, even for better cpus |
| 16:39 | Dibblah1_ | It's the Gentoo Philosophy. |
| 16:39 | --- | <<-- emes [~emes@ool-43566766.dyn.optonline.net] has quit ("Leaving") |
| 16:40 | --- | User: *** Dibblah1_ is now known as Dibblah |
| 16:40 | Chutt | i've seen -march=athlon-xp produce 50% slower code than -march=pentiumpro on very math intensive stuff |
| 16:40 | Chutt | on an xp, of course |
